What is NotebookLM?

At its core, NotebookLM is a research and writing assistant that works with your content. Unlike general-purpose AI chatbots such as ChatGPT or Gemini, which draw from the vast expanse of the open internet, NotebookLM’s responses are grounded in the specific sources you upload. This fundamental difference is crucial for academic work, as it ensures that the generated insights, summaries, and analyses are directly tied to your curated research materials, complete with in-text citations that link back to the original source .

NotebookLM is built on the understanding that academic work is a conversation with existing scholarship. Key features for academics include:

  • Source-Grounded AI: Your content, your answers. This ensures the relevance and accuracy of the AI’s outputs, mitigating the risk of hallucinations.

  • Multimodal Capabilities: NotebookLM can process a wide range of source materials, including PDFs, Google Docs, web URLs, and even YouTube videos, allowing you to centralize your research from diverse formats.

  • Privacy: A critical consideration for all academics—your data is not used to train the model, ensuring the confidentiality of your research.
